I want to change to a new wifi password on the router I just received to the same wifi password as I have used for the last 1 year.

Router is Zyxcel EX3300-T0 with Firmware version "V5.50(ABVY.5.4)C0" and WWAN package version "1.26".

The current wifi password on the router is 8 digits, consisting of uppercase letters and numbers.
When I try and change the password it asks me to have the password as 8 digits, uppercase, lowercase with number and special characters.

The password I want to set is 8 digits only uppercase and from the alphabet.
An example would be "ABCDEFGH"

This seems not to be possible via the UI, is there a possibility to turn of this requirement via UI, or a hidden API or via Command Line Interface ( CLI ) over SSH?
